Mikroe Mikromedia 4 for Kinetis Resistive FPI with Frame

MikroE MIKROE-6211 Mikromedia 4 for Kinetis Resistive FPI with Frame has features that allow it to be expanded beyond multimedia-based applications. The Mikromedia 4 for Kinetis Resistive FPI offers Wi-Fi® and RF connectivity options, a digital motion sensor, battery charging functionality, a piezo-buzzer, an SD card reader, and RTC.

The MikroE Mikromedia 4 for Kinetis Resistive FPI with frame has three mikroBUS™ Shuttle connectors, a recent addition to the mikroBUS™ standard in the form of a 2x8-pin IDC header with 1.27mm (50mil) pitch. The mikroBUS Shuttle extension board is an add-on board supplied with the conventional mikroBUS socket, which guarantees compatibility with 894 Click boards™.
